Verschachtelte Tabellen: nur innere sichtbar

Hi,

um im Voraus Schwierigkeiten zu vermeiden - mit PHP kenne ichmich recht gut aus, ebenso mit javascript, bin momentan wahrscheinlich einfach zu blöd den fehler in meinem Code zu finden.

Also hier mein Problem:

Ich gebe ganz am Anfang von meinem PHP-Code den Kopf meiner Tabelle in HTML aus:

 




















dann fülle ich diese Tabelle mittels einer Funktion tablle0():

function tabelle 0()

for ($i=0; $i";
echo „“;
echo „“;
echo „“;
echo " „.$a[$i].“";
echo " „.$b[$i].“";
echo " „.$c[$i].“";
echo " „.$d[$i].“";
echo " „.$e[$i].“";
echo " „.$f[$i].“";
echo " „.$g[$i].“";
echo " „.$h[$i].“";
echo " „.$i[$i].“";
echo " „.$j[$i].“";
echo " „.$k[$i].“";
echo " „.$l[$i].“";
echo " „.$m[$i].“";
echo " „.$n[$i].“";
echo " „.$o[$i].“";
echo " „.$p[$i].“";
echo " „.$q[$i].“";
echo " „.$r[$i].“";
echo " „.$s[$i].“";
echo " „.$t[$i].“";
echo " „.$u[$i].“";
echo „“;

tabelle1($i);

}
}
in dieser funktion rufe ich wiederrum eine zweite funktion auf, die in dere tabelle eine zweite zeichnen soll-tabelle1():

function tabelle1()
echo „“;

for ($z=0; $z";

echo „“;

echo „“;

echo „“;

echo „“;

echo „“;

echo „“;

echo „“;
echo " „;
echo " „.$a[$z].““;
echo " „.$b[$z].“";
echo " „.$c[$z].“";
echo " „.$d[$z].“";
echo " „.$e[$z].“";
echo " „.$f[$z].“";
echo " „.$g[$z].“";
echo " „.$h[$z].“";
echo " „.$i[$z].“";
echo " „.$j[$z].“";
echo " „.$k[$z].“";
echo " „.$l[$z].“";
echo " „.$m[$z].“";
echo " „.$n[$z].“";
echo " „.$o[$z].“";
echo " „.$p[$z].“";
echo " „.$q[$z].“";
echo " „.$r[$z].“";
echo " „.$s[$z].“";
echo " „.$t[$z].“";
echo " „.$u[$z].“";
echo „“;
;

}
echo „“;
}

und schließe am Schluss meine Tabelle von oben wieder in HTML

Jetzt kommt mein problem:

Bei der Haupttabelle wird nur der Kopf und die erste Zeile richtig angezeigt, die innderen Tabellen werden alle korrekt angezeigt, aber der rest ist reiner Text.

Hoffentlich kann mir einer helfen.

Hinweise:

  • ich verwende am Anfang ein Javascript, das bei klicken auf die Bilder (+,-) die Bilder tauscht und die inneren tabellen aufklappt.
  • Die Daten stammen aus einer Stückliste, die dynamisch von einer Datenbank in einem Textfile gespeichert werden und ich lese sie mittels PHP in Arrays

Im Voraus schon mal danke

Hab grad mein Problem selbst gelöst:

Für alle die es interessiert:

innerhalb der ersten funkion schreibt man am Schluss, nach dem , innerhalb der Forschleife den Aufruf der tabelle1() eine zelle

im genauen sollte es dann so ausssehen:

tabelle1()

x steht für die Spaltenanzahl der Haupttabelle.

wenn man das so macht klappts, sieht zwar nicht gerade top aus, aber das bekomme ich auch noch hin.

Gruß

Schlafmütze